Strobe
Jun 30, 2014
GW BRAINWORMS CREW
The problem with Assault Marines is that anything you want them to do can be accomplished by almost anything for slightly more points but also literally double (or more) the effectiveness. Especially since they didn't get any cheaper when tactical marines did.

For example: 75 points gets you five Assault Marines, which get to do a total of 16 attacks on the charge at S4, AP-, 1 damage. 85 points gets you five Vanguard Veterans with two chainswords each, which get to do a total of 26 attacks on the charge with the same profile. A little over 13% more points gets you a little over 62% more attacks with the same weapons.
